There are two areas of focus for Controls Engineers within Impossible Mining.
The first is related to our unique underwater robotic arm. Traditional underwater arms are slow serial arms where our robotics require high speed parallel robotics working underwater to achieve the speed that we need. We also require the arms to not disturb the seabed sediment as they pick rocks from the surface of the seabed. Driving these combined and conflicting performance characteristics is one of the core challenges for this position.
The second area of focus is the vehicle localization and control. Subsea vehicles employ a unique set of sensors since GPS is not available underwater and at depths of 5000m and greater underwater special acoustic positioning is required. Acoustic positioning aided with doppler velocity, inertial and optical measurements are combined to determine the position of the vehicle. The control system needs to vary the states of operation switching between operation at the surface, through the water column and then at the seabed, tracking over the seabed at a constant height while the vehicle drives along. The control algorithm increases with complexity as the mass of the vehicle increases through the collection process and thus the inertia and location of the center of mass of the AUV changes. We also need to offset the added weight though adjusting both a combination of buoyancy and vertical thrust. This needs to be done to both minimize battery consumption and minimize or eliminate environmental impact.
As we further develop the controls algorithms, understanding the feed forward impacts of the arms on the state of the vehicle may be important for overall vehicle performance.
